  • Specificity

    The aE11 monoclonal was first reported to bind to a neoepitope exposed on polymerized C9 when incorporated into the human terminal complement complex (PubMed ID: 4035298). It was subsequently shown that this antibody also cross reacts with the C5b-8 complex and purified C8 alpha-gamma. It does not react with native C9 or C8 proteins (PubMed ID: 2424021).

    ab66768 binds both membrane-bound MAC (active) and fluid-phase SC5b-9 complexes (inactive) (Mollnes TE, Harboe M (1987).

  •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ections) - Anti-C5b-9 + C5b-8 antibody [aE11] (ab66768)
    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ections) - Anti-C5b-9 + C5b-8 antibody [aE11] (ab66768)Image from Ekser B et al., PLoS One. 2012;7(1):e29720. Epub 2012 Jan 11. Fig 3.; doi:10.1371/journal.pone.0029720; January 11, 2012, PLoS ONE 7(1): e29720.

    ab66768 staining C5b-9 + C5b-8 (red) in porcine liver tissue by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ections).

    Tissue was taken from allotransplants of wild-type or a1,3-galactosyltransferase gene-knockout (GTKO) pig liver, 2 hours after grafting or at necroscopy (nec). Tissue was fixed with paraformaldehyde and blocked with 20% donkey serum for 1 hour at room temperature, before being incubated with primary antibody (1/100 in diluent).

  •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ections) - Anti-C5b-9 + C5b-8 antibody [aE11] (ab66768)
    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ections) - Anti-C5b-9 + C5b-8 antibody [aE11] (ab66768)This image is courtesy of an anonymous Abreview

    ab66768 staining C5b-9 + C5b-8 in monkey retina cord tissue sections by Immunohistochemistry (IHC-Fr - frozen sections).

    Tissue was fixed with paraformaldehyde, permeabilized with 0.5% Triton-X and blocked with 4% serum for 30 minutes at 22°C. Samples were incubated with primary antibody (1/500) for 16 hours at 4°C. An Alexa Fluor® 488-conjugated goat anti-mouse IgG polyclonal (1/300) was used as the secondary antibody. Counterstained with DAPI. Magnification: 20X.
